矿机中哈希sha256算法部分的硬件电路的设计与验证

@哈希算法 sha256 异步串口 ASIC前端及FPGA验证

报告内容

一、 研究背景 1
二、 电路设计 2

  1. 整体设计与模块划分 2
  2. 串口模块设计 2
  3. 信息预处理模块设计 3
  4. Sha256迭代计算模块设计 4
  5. 异步FIFO模块设计 6
    三、 电路前仿真 7
  6. 验证方案设计 7
  7. 验证流程 7
  8. 验证结果 8
    四、 逻辑综合 11
  9. 综合脚本 11
  10. 综合面积报告 12
  11. 综合时序报告 13
    五、 形式验证 18
    六、 FPGA验证 19
  12. FPGA综合时序报告 19
  13. 系统资源报告 21
  14. FPGA验证方案设计 22
  15. 测试结果 22
    七、 心得体会 24

电路整体结构设计

该系统由UART串口模块,FIFO模块,消息预处理模块,算法迭代模块等模块,具体结构如下图:
矿机中哈希sha256算法部分的硬件电路的设计与验证

电路的仿真

矿机中哈希sha256算法部分的硬件电路的设计与验证

FPGA验证

矿机中哈希sha256算法部分的硬件电路的设计与验证

报告见我的资源

需要源代码的请私信联系我!